An exciting, easy read, one you can breeze through. Is it deep? No. Is it entertaining? Absolutely!
Great as a palate cleanser or for getting out of a reading slump.
Keep in mind that it's YA, for those who are not the target audience. One character definitely scratches the back of their head too much and there is a lot of “dorky/funny” dialogue as well as a teen romance I did not care about, but if that's something you can overlook, you’re still going to have fun with this one.
